A chiropractor like Clay Chiropractic And Rehabilitation helps patients with problems of the neuromusculoskeletal system, which includes nerves, bones, muscles, ligaments, and tendons. Chiropractors use spinal adjustments and manipulation, as well as other clinical interventions, to manage health issues such as back and neck pain. Some chiropractors apply procedures like massage therapy, rehabilitative exercise, ultrasound and spinal adjustments and manipulation. A chiropractor focuses on the patients overall health and might refer patients to other healthcare professionals if necessary.

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1619824943, we treat the final digit (3)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 77.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(80 - 77 = 3).
